A Neutrostructural Methodology for Empowering New-Quality Productivity Toward High Quality Development in the Smart Elderly Care Industry

The transformation of the elderly care industry into a smart, high-quality sector is
central to addressing the demographic shifts in aging populations globally. This study introduces
a novel methodological framework rooted in neutrostructural logic, designed to empower "new
quality productivity" a paradigm that transcends traditional efficiency and embraces
technological adaptability, social inclusivity, and ethical responsiveness. By applying the
theoretical foundations of NeutroGeometry and AntiGeometry, the methodology accounts for
the indeterminacy and partial truth inherent in complex socio-technical systems. Through this
lens, we analyze the smart elderly care ecosystem as a dynamic, adaptive network, driven by
uncertainty, human-centric design, and intelligent infrastructure. The paper further presents
implementation models and evaluative insights that inform policy development, workforce
training, and technology integration for sustainable, high-quality growth.
